One that keeps on keepin&#8217; on is one Patrice Pike out of Austin,Texas. She has been more than just\u00a0a performer HMR has followed over the years in that she provides her thoughts on life in a way that only she can. PP\u00a0has a genuine sense of humor, has an eye contact rapport with an audience like few I&#8217;ve ever\u00a0seen and is a genuine soulfull person who does not just give lip service to her fans.\u00a0<\/span><\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-family: 'times new roman', times; font-size: small;\"><span style=\"font-family: 'times new roman', times;\">Rarely do you get a chance like this night at killer McGonigel&#8217;s Mucky Duck in Houston to see her with a full band in tow. Pike has been a mainstay at this venue for her pay what you can Happy Hours on Wednesdays where she plays solo or maybe one or two musicians with her.<\/span><\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-family: 'times new roman', times; font-size: small;\"><span style=\"font-family: 'times new roman', times;\">Tonight she had Seth Orwell on drums, antimated and very good Glen McGregor on bass, Laran Snyder on backing vocals and old buddy Wayne Sutton of Sister Seven fame on smokin&#8217; lead guitar.\u00a0 Sutton is the piece to this puzzle that takes Pike&#8217;s music to rarified air compared to when he is not there!\u00a0 Tonight was also special when the opening act at 7pm, Sweet Sara Hickman,\u00a0jumped on stage for a few tunes. Nice.<\/span><\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-family: 'times new roman', times; font-size: small;\"><span style=\"font-family: 'times new roman', times;\">&#8220;Rufus&#8221; was the opener and the gig clicked on all cylinders from there.\u00a0 With Sutton buzz sawing in the background throughout \u00a0chestnuts like &#8220;Jack Knife Girl&#8221;, &#8220;Under the Radar&#8221;, fave of mine &#8220;Sweet November&#8221; and roof raising &#8220;Babylon&#8221; had the audience\u00a0soaking in the Pike experience full on. You never get a gig mailed in by PP and she relentlessly tours covering\u00a0community theaters, clubs of all sizes, house concerts to festivals along the way.<\/span><\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-family: 'times new roman', times; font-size: small;\"><span style=\"font-family: 'times new roman', times;\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" title=\"Image\" src=\"http:\/\/www.houstonmusicreview.com\/mambo\/images\/stories\/2014concert\/082214-PP1.jpg\" alt=\"Image\" width=\"273\" height=\"200\" align=\"left\" border=\"0\" hspace=\"6\" \/>Considering\u00a0barely out of high school\u00a0is when she got started, she takes amazing care of herself and the touring has not taken a toll on her ultra strong pipes at all.\u00a0 It would be great\u00a0to see\u00a0this squad in the studio and pump out some new tunes for sure.\u00a0 The five piece seemed to mesh quite well and Sutton can improvise so well with her its uncanny.\u00a0<\/span><\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-family: 'times new roman', times; font-size: small;\"><span style=\"font-family: 'times new roman', times;\">Also somehow Pike has found the time to be co-founder and executive director of the Grace Foundation of Texas, an orginization that provides services for young adult survivors of homelessness.\u00a0<\/span><\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-family: 'times new roman', times; font-size: small;\"><span style=\"font-family: 'times new roman', times;\">Patrice&#8217;s latest release, &#8220;The Calling&#8221;, was released in June, 2013 with its production partly made possible by fan funding.\u00a0 I feel truly honored to consider\u00a0this Austin\/Texas Music Hall of Famer a friend.\u00a0 Grabbin&#8217; on to her for a heartfelt hugaroo and peck on the cheek before the show,\u00a0I told her HMR was covering the gig and not to be nervous.\u00a0 Her sincere reply of &#8220;I&#8217;m never nervous when you are here&#8221; said volumes.\u00a0 The lady lives a full and loving life and we&#8217;re all better for it at her gigs.\u00a0\u00a0 Just watch out when this lil pepper pot grabs onto a wine goblet as big as her!\u00a0\u00a0<\/span><\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-family: 'times new roman', times; font-size: small;\"><span style=\"font-family: 'times new roman', times;\">HA!\u00a0&#8230;&#8230;&#8230;&#8230;&#8230;..
